How would it feel to have unquestionable confidence? To know in your mind, in your heart, and in the very depths of your being that you are creating the life you've always wanted? This book brings together entrepreneurship and philosophy to reveal that we're much closer to that kind of life than we think. In Wired for Success: Practical Philosophies to Master Entrepreneurship & Live Life on Your Terms, Edmond Abramyan shares insights gained from building a six-figure business online, burning out, crashing down, and then transforming himself again to experience even greater heights-this time, sustained with fulfillment. Abramyan delivers practical techniques to help you get out of your own way and loosen up to the creativity flowing within you. In this book, you will learn about key elements that control how we experience reality. Finally, you'll understand why some people see a world that others don't-a world that will give you an incredible advantage in the marketplace and in creating life on YOUR own terms. LibraryThing Early Reviewer Copy

Man, oh, man! I was pleasantly surprised by this book! I don't think I have highlighted so many passages in a book before! This is one of those books that you should just read over and over again. Why? Because much of what he talks about in the book is not new thinking, but how he presents it is straightforward and makes it easy to revisit. Backed by quotes and stories from long-gone philosophers to modern-day gurus, the information makes you feel like you are not alone in these emotional struggles. It supports the idea that all these personal strives are most certainly connected to your entrepreneurial spirit. This aspect of the book is greatly appreciated. In the past, I have blamed my business troubles on "not being a business person." When in fact, many of these struggles can be improved by self-actualization! I highly recommend this book to anyone feeling stuck in their business. Sometimes the solution is not always what you think it may be. ( )
